This is the first major work on the Huastec Indians of northeastern Mexico.a disjunct group of Maya speakers who, for some 3,000 years, have interacted with elements of a diverse flora on the humid tropical slope from the Sierra Madre to the Gulf of Mexico . While this study contains a wealth of new information on Teenek lifeways, shamanism, illness beliefs, subsistence patterns, ethnogeograph, cosmology, and botanical resources, its major contribution to the field of human ecology lies in the integration of botanical and anthropological approaches to the dynamics of plant-human interrelationship.
